c语言exit函数的用途是什么

627
2023/12/9 10:27:19
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

C语言中的exit函数用于终止程序的执行并返回操作系统。它是标准库函数stdlib.h中的一个函数。

exit函数的主要用途有以下两个:

  1. 终止程序:通过调用exit函数,程序可以正常或异常退出。exit函数会停止程序的执行,并将控制权返回给操作系统。在退出之前,它会清理和关闭程序中的打开文件、释放动态分配的内存等资源。
  2. 返回状态码:exit函数可以指定一个整数值作为程序的返回状态码。这个状态码可以被操作系统用于判断程序的执行情况。通常情况下,返回0表示程序执行成功,非零值表示程序执行出现错误或异常。

示例代码:

#include <stdlib.h>
#include <stdio.h>

int main() {
    // 程序正常退出,返回状态码0
    exit(0);

    // 程序异常退出,返回状态码1
    exit(1);
}

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: c语言中fabs的用法是什么